Designed for
:
Native or non-native teachers of French as a foreign
language / second language in France or abroad.
General objectives :
- Learn or enhance knowledge of teaching/learning techniques
of French as a foreign language /second language
- Develop teaching skills and classroom practices in interactive communicative
situations
- Help learners to develop their creativity and intellectual abilities
- Look at different areas such as motivation, learning styles, etc
- Reflect on different teaching experiences and meet specialists (trainers,
course designers, editors…)
N.B :
•
Depending on the dates of your course, observing multicultural
classes may form the basis for discussion on various aspects of teaching
and learning strategies. Teachers will be able to analyze classroom
practice, features of materials used, and how to present and link activities
together.
•
The core module and workshops may also be combined with
an intensive or extensive language course to enable you to upgrade your
general French or to study French for special purposes in a group or
on a one-to-one basis.
